After the change in PCB administration, Pakistan’s sensational singer Ali Sethi has misplaced a gig which was provided to him in the course of the administration of former PCB chairman Rameez Raza.

This got here after Najam Sethi, Ali Sethi’s father was appointed as the brand new chairman of the Pakistan Cricket Board. According to media experiences, Ali was contracted by the then PCB administration to compose and sing for the eighth version of the Pakistan Super League (PSL).

However, experiences counsel that Ali was requested by his father Najam Sethi to choose out of the PSL 8 anthem to keep away from battle of curiosity and any pointless controversy that might pose a possible menace to the picture of the chairman. did.

Meanwhile, the venue of the PSL 8 opening ceremony has additionally been a matter of concern lately. Initial plans had been for the opening ceremony and first recreation of the match to be held in Multan, however experiences counsel that the PSL sponsors want to shift the venue to Karachi. A closing determination on this matter is anticipated within the subsequent one week.

Former PCB chairman Najam Sethi returned on the helm of the board’s new 14-member administration committee after Rameez Raja was relieved of his duties and the physique’s structure was amended following Pakistan’s 3-0 defeat to England in a Test sequence. Canceled later. final month.

PSL 8 is scheduled to start on February 13, with the ultimate set to be performed on March 19. However, the official schedule of the match has not but been launched by the administration.

Ali Sethi, 38, rose to prominence in 2009 along with his debut novel, The Wish Maker. He has been round for fairly a while and sang a music for Mira Nair’s 2012 movie The Reluctant Fundamentalist and appeared in a number of seasons of Pakistan Coke Studio. But, it was her collaboration with She Gill for the music Paasuri that made her some of the viral sensations of the 12 months. Released on February 6 this 12 months, the music turned probably the most seen Coke Studio video ever and at present holds 473 million views. The pasuri was beloved by folks on either side of the border and have become some of the used ones on Instagram reels.
